顶级域名(Top-Level Domain,简称TLD)是互联网域名系统(DNS)中的最高级别域名。它位于域名的最右侧,通常用于标识网站的分类或地理位置。顶级域名分为通用顶级域名(gTLD)和国家代码顶级域名(ccTLD)。
解决方法:
可以使用正则表达式或编程语言中的字符串处理函数来提取顶级域名。以下是一个使用Python的示例代码:
import re
def extract_top_level_domain(url):
# 使用正则表达式匹配顶级域名
match = re.search(r'(?<=\.)([a-zA-Z]{2,}|[a-zA-Z0-9-]{2,}\.[a-zA-Z]{2,})$', url)
if match:
return match.group(0)
else:
return None
# 示例
url = "https://www.example.com/path/to/page"
tld = extract_top_level_domain(url)
print(tld) # 输出: com
参考链接:
顶级域名是互联网域名系统中的最高级别域名,分为通用顶级域名和国家代码顶级域名。提取顶级域名可以通过正则表达式或编程语言中的字符串处理函数来实现。合理选择和使用顶级域名有助于网站的分类、品牌识别和搜索引擎优化。
领取专属 10元无门槛券
手把手带您无忧上云